They emigrated to New Ulm, MN in 1866. Maria was born about 1844. Her parents were both born about 1816 in this area I believe. Maria came over on the MISSISSIPPI from Bremen, in July 1866. She had siblings named Peter, Anna, and Wenzel, Jr that came along. They were younger than Maria (Mary). Maria married Hubert John Knott in 1867 in New Ulm, and raised 11 children. They died in St. Joseph, IA and are buried there. I am interested in any family from these children, or the original Prokosch families in the Bischofteinitz area of Bohemia, either in the U.S. or back in the republic of Czech. I have just recently learned of Maria's parents names and her siblings. I have several people involved in assisting me in this search, in the New Ulm area, and in the St. Joseph, IA area, where they had lived last. We don't know where Wenzel and Catherine died for sure, and don't know where their other children lived and married and died.
